garmin forerunner 405

So has all the hype been worth it? Come and check it out for yourself. After many months of speculation, the Garmin Forerunner 405 is finally here! Loaded with serious training features, the 405 continuously monitors your time, distance, pace, calories burned, and heart rate (when paired with heart rate monitor). Each run is stored in memory so you can review and analyze the data to see how you've improved. You can even download recorded courses to compete against previous workouts or race a Virtual Partner®. Customize Forerunner’s data screens for instant feedback while you train. Once you’ve logged the miles, innovative ANT+Sport™ wireless technology automatically transfers data to your computer when the Forerunner is in range. No cables, no hookups. This high performance GPS watch is easy to use and comfortable to wear when not training. Simply tap the touch bezel to change screens without fumbling for a button. Forerunner 405 comes in two color options — black or green — to fit your style.

brooks addiction 8

Our most popular motion control shoe has been updated! Like other Brooks shoes, the new Addiction has made the switch from a S-257 to a MoGo midsole. So what you say? MoGo offers a 40% increase in cushioning, 22% more energy return, and 33% less fatigue than S-257. Who wouldn't want that? And, with its linear platform and progressive diagonal rollbar, the shoe is as supportive as ever. We know that you overpronating runners out ther are going to love this one.
